скинь пример текста, заверну попроще
Винт_1 Цена_магазина_1 Цена_магазина_2
Винт_2 Цена_магазина_1 Цена_магазина_2
Цена_магазина_1 берется с URL и в коде прописана как <span class="item_value">стопицот тыщ</span>. Вот как именно этот класс вытащить, вернее его содержимое, я и не догоняю.
т.е. Цена_магазина_1 = стопицот тыщ?
поделись страницей или html кодом. что-то я догоняю
=IMPORTXML ("http://www.dns-shop.ru/catalog/i129738/zhestkij-disk-sata-3-500gb-seagate-7200-barracuda.html"; "//*[@id="price_item"]")
должна импортировать цену, но выдает ошибку синтаксиса. Но ведь ImportXML("https://en.wikipedia.org/wiki/Moon_landing"; "//a/@href")
работает. Значит XPath найден не верно. Подскажите, как его правильно прописать.
Фейл с VLOOKUP. Google Spreadsheets не обновляет содержимое ячейки при открытии документа. Попробовал IMPORTXML, тоже не прокатило, XPath не помогает. Что-то не так делаю. Например, функция видаКавычки в @id="price_item" надо на одинарные поменять, с двойными получается разрыв целостности текстаКод: [Выделить]=IMPORTXML ("http://www.dns-shop.ru/catalog/i129738/zhestkij-disk-sata-3-500gb-seagate-7200-barracuda.html"; "//*[@id="price_item"]")
должна импортировать цену, но выдает ошибку синтаксиса. Но ведьКод: [Выделить]ImportXML("https://en.wikipedia.org/wiki/Moon_landing"; "//a/@href")
работает. Значит XPath найден не верно. Подскажите, как его правильно прописать.
<div class="price_block clear">
<span class="price">
4 530.00 р. <sup><span class="tooltiped" title="Товар по этой цене можно приобрести только за наличный расчет при заказе в интернет-магазине" data-icon=""></span></sup>
<span class="nodiscount">
4 620.00 р.</span>
</span>
</div>
http://www.kursk.ret.ru/?&pn=prod&gid=787662 - импортируется без проблем.
Получилось импортировать цену. Но обнаружились проблемы:По первому - возможно, сработает подставить вместо www в адресе - имя города (см. на dns-shop в выборе города есть линки, типа barnaul.dns-shop.ru итп).
http://www.dns-shop.ru/catalog/i129738/zhestkij-disk-sata-3-500gb-seagate-7200-barracuda.html - импортируется цена из магазина не в нужном регионе.
http://salon2116.ru/catalog/hdd/121637?sphrase_id=408394 - импортируется две цена в два столбца (вторая цена по безналу). Как импортировать только первую? (вид в формуле "//span[@class = 'price']" )
По первому - возможно, сработает подставить вместо www в адресе - имя города (см. на dns-shop в выборе города есть линки, типа barnaul.dns-shop.ru итп).1 - не сработало, тоже сразу так подумал. (решил вычитанием разницы в процентах, она похоже фиксированная, но время покажет)
По второму - надо уже получившееся обрезать простыми текстовыми функциями таблиц (LEFT, SEARCH, возможно MID)